Requesting security review of the new rule-evaluation path. Rules are authored by merchants as declarative JSON and compiled server-side; the concern is that the comparison operators accept arbitrary field paths, which could let a crafted rule read order fields outside the shipping context. We added an allowlist of addressable fields plus depth limits, and denied rules now log with full context. Please verify the allowlist covers nested discount objects. The build under review is identified by the token below.

session token of bahip-hawep = htk4_b0c1

## v5.2.0 — Broker Upgrade

Upgraded the Fernspool message broker from 3.8 to 4.1 across all regions. Changes: quorum queues replace mirrored queues, connection limits raised to 10k, and the legacy STOMP listener is removed. Consumers on the old client library must upgrade before the next release train. Rollback snapshot retained for 14 days. Release approval and rollback authority sit with the upgrade owner.

account owner for kafop-haweg: Pelax Gilael Istir

MEMO — Kettling Depot Receiving

Uniform sets for the new Kettling depot arrive Wednesday via Ashgrove courier: 40 boxes, sorted by size, manifest attached to box one. Check the count at the dock before signing; shortages go straight to stores, not the courier. The hand-over instruction the courier will follow is set out below.

drop instructions, tafof-baguf: the holmir gilox courier leaves the sormir ulaok holdor ledger at gate 5596 under passcode 257343

Onboarding note — Facilities desk, Ostler Park site

Data-centre cage visits: escort required, no exceptions. Visitors sign the cage log, leave bags at the desk. Max two visitors per escort. Photography prohibited. Cage doors auto-lock after 20 seconds — do not prop them. Report any unlatched cage immediately to the duty engineer. Cage vestibule keypad takes the code below.

staff pass of kagup-fajog = bdg-QCHVQW-99665837